What I Look For Before Buying
When I shop for a yearly calendar board, I focus on a few important things. I want the board to be easy to read, simple to clean, and large enough to fit all my notes. I also pay attention to the material, layout, and how well it fits the space where I plan to use it.
Size and Layout
I always check the size first. If I need to write many reminders, I prefer a larger board with enough space in each date box. If I am using it for a small office or kitchen wall, I choose a compact version that still gives me a clear yearly view. I also consider whether the layout shows all 12 months clearly and whether the font is easy to read from a distance.
Surface Quality
For me, the writing surface matters a lot. I prefer a smooth, stain-resistant dry erase surface because it makes writing and erasing easier. A good board should not leave ghost marks after repeated use. I look for one that wipes clean quickly with a dry cloth or eraser.
Durability and Frame
I want a board that lasts, so I check the frame and overall build quality. A sturdy aluminum or reinforced frame usually feels more reliable to me. If the board will be moved often, I also look for something lightweight but still strong enough to handle regular use.
Mounting and Installation
I prefer a board that is easy to hang. Some boards come with mounting hardware, which saves me time. Before buying, I make sure I know whether it can be mounted vertically or horizontally and whether it fits the wall space I have available. Easy installation is a big plus for me.
Accessories Included
I like it when the board includes useful extras such as markers, an eraser, push pins, or magnetic accessories. These add convenience and can save me from buying everything separately. If accessories are included, I still check their quality because I want them to be practical and durable.
Magnetic vs. Non-Magnetic
I decide between magnetic and non-magnetic boards based on how I plan to use it. A magnetic board is helpful if I want to attach notes, reminders, or photos. A non-magnetic board can still work well if I only need writing space. For my own use, I usually prefer magnetic boards because they offer more flexibility.
Best Use Cases
I find dry erase yearly calendar boards useful in many settings. At home, I use them for family plans, appointments, and holidays. In an office, they help me track projects and deadlines. In a classroom, they can be great for school events and academic planning. I choose the style based on where I need it most.
Easy Cleaning and Maintenance
I always think about how easy the board will be to maintain. A good board should clean up with minimal effort. I avoid boards that stain easily or require special cleaners. For regular use, I want something that stays neat and readable all year long.
